Relaxed place in the Doubletree offering an unfussy American menu, craft beer & breakfast buffet. Based on 63 reviews, the restaurant has received a rating of 3.8 stars. Price

A little expensive, but pretty tasty. We had the rotisserie chicken with the baked mac and new potatoes, which was really good, and the pulled chicken sandwich which was so good. That was about $30. 2 vodka red bulls = $20. It’s a clean restaurant and the bartender was really nice. Unfortunately there wasn’t the complimentary breakfast for guests when we went, so we skipped breakfast.

We got complementary breakfast with our room. It was okay with something for everyone. We ordered room service the first night and it was kinda expensive. We also were not told, nor did it say anywhere on the menu that a 20% tip was included… they delivered everything in a brown paper bag with the receipt in the bag so we tipped at the door. He got a big tip! I think it should say somewhere that it’s added on. The food was average but good and as easy as it could get, but it’s priced for that. The restaurant seemed clean and guy going around was nice.

Fine little market style restaurant, bar and coffee shop in the DoubleTree Hotel near the main entrance. Servers have always been nice. Our room rate has always included the free breakfast buffet which is not super fancy but is very nice and significantly better than anything the Hampton ever has. Been to the bar a few times late at night for decent wine choices. Free WiFi makes this a great place to work.
